什么是305 HTTP状态代码?如何正确使用?

Sar*_*rah 4 proxy http http-status-codes

我发现:"必须通过Location字段给出的代理访问所请求的资源.Location字段给出了代理的URI.收件人应该通过代理重复这个请求.305个响应必须只生成原始服务器."

如何正确使用?如果给定的URL下没有代理怎么办?

pro*_*php 8

它是一个重定向,当你想告诉客户从其他地方获取内容时,你可以使用它.给定的URI在单词的通俗使用中不一定是"代理".它只是最初请求的内容存在的另一个地方.

人们用它来实现负载平衡.我不确定客户端是否正确实现了它,所以如果你只是想重定向,那么使用302会更安全.

编辑

预期的使用示例,如HTTP RFC中所述:假设您有一个缓存代理,其中的内容来自真实服务器(原始服务器).如果某人以某种方式直接访问真实服务器,您将发送305,并且您希望他们从代理中获取它.